Replacing the Fob

Many cars make use of fobs to begin the vehicle and gain access to. An auto locksmith can often replace the fob and give you a second one, particularly in the event that you've lost it or have damaged one. They can also reprogram a key that is already in use. This is ideal for people who lose their keys frequently or require to have a backup.

These keys can be used in conjunction with vehicles that have transponder keys, including keys made in 1990 or earlier. The keys have an electronic signal that is sent to the computer of the vehicle which is how they begin the motor. A professional locksmith can program new keys using the code that is saved on file at the manufacturer provided you have proof of ownership, like the registration or the VIN number.

The locksmith will have to connect to the car's computer through the on-board diagnostics port (OBD), usually located under the steering column. The locksmith will then be able to enter programming mode to alter or update the code to the fob of the key and remove the previous one from the car system. This is a faster option rather than calling your dealer, which will likely take longer and may require you to visit their dealership.

Making New Keys

An auto locksmith can cut you a brand new key right on the spot. They can cut traditional keys, a smart key or even replace the fob of your key.

They'll also be able to enter your glove box or trunk and replace any lock that's been damaged. They'll be able to accomplish this right on the spot because they'll be equipped with the appropriate tools and technologies. This is a well-known service that automotive locksmiths provide.

The locksmith will require details about your vehicle before he can make the new key. The year of your car, for instance will determine the kind of key you'll need. This will impact the amount it will cost to purchase a new key.

In certain instances your car keys could break in the lock or ignition. This can be very frustrating, especially if it happens in an emergency situation. An 24 7 automotive locksmith locksmith can solve this issue using a specific tool to remove the broken key from the lock. They'll then replace it or program a replacement fob for you.

You'll most likely need to show the locksmith your car registration and proof of ownership before you can get a new key. This is to ensure that they're making the key for the right vehicle. It's not unusual for some dealers to allow you to get a new key without having the title in hand in the event that you have a picture identification and your registration.
